There is approved planning permission to replace the whole side/back with a full extension which includes relocating the bathroom to the first floor of the house, however we have estimates of £45k+ and were wondering if there was anything we could do in the shorter term on a lower budget.
Some initial thoughts/options we had:
- Rebuild just the side extension with a proper roof
- Put a ceiling in to hide the existing ugly plastic roof
- Raise the floor to bring inline with the rest of the ground floor
- Knock through the wall into the dining room to open up the space (this would likely require a beam?)
- Move the kitchen/dining room door to the left of the property (near the stairs to first floor) to make room for an L corner kitchen on the left hand side, which would look better then the current wrap-around corner kitchen)
Would love to hear what others might think about options.
